Mr Darcy, Even Better Looking Than Before…
It may true be that a single man in possession of a good fortune, must be in want of a wife, but it may also be true that a good woman with a pension for the classics, is in want of book covers that mirror the quality of the words inside.
I’ve long been a fan of Jane Austen’s Pride and Prejudice (the book as well as the A&E version), but my love for it has just been rekindled with the release of Ruben Toledo‘s couture-inspired book cover. Gorgeously drawn with oil, watercolor and pencil, the cover instantly modernizes the beloved classic, making it even more desirable than before.
